pvmfw: Apply debug policy from config to VM FDT
Apply the debug config device tree overlay obtained from the
configuration data to the final device tree that the payload will
receive.

+/// Applies the debug policy device tree overlay to the pVM DT.
+///
+/// # Safety
+///
+/// When an error is returned by this function, the input `Fdt` should be discarded as it may have
+/// have been partially corrupted during the overlay application process.
+unsafe fn apply_debug_policy(
+ fdt: &mut libfdt::Fdt,
+ debug_policy: &mut [u8],
+) -> Result<(), RebootReason> {
+ let overlay = libfdt::Fdt::from_mut_slice(debug_policy).map_err(|e| {
+ error!("Failed to load the debug policy overlay: {e}");
+ RebootReason::InvalidConfig
+ })?;
+
+ fdt.unpack().map_err(|e| {
+ error!("Failed to unpack DT for debug policy: {e}");
+ RebootReason::InternalError
+ })?;
+
+ let fdt = fdt.apply_overlay(overlay).map_err(|e| {
+ error!("Failed to apply the debug policy overlay: {e}");
+ RebootReason::InvalidConfig
+ })?;
+
+ fdt.pack().map_err(|e| {
+ error!("Failed to re-pack DT after debug policy: {e}");
+ RebootReason::InternalError
+ })
+}
